As an Associate Director in KPMG’s Finance Transformation team, you will play a pivotal role in shaping the future of finance for leading insurance clients. You will lead complex transformation programmes, drive operational excellence, and deliver innovative solutions that align finance functions with business strategy. This is an opportunity to work at the forefront of finance transformation, leveraging cutting-edge technologies and methodologies to deliver lasting impact.

 

A snapshot of your peer group:

  • Qualified accountant and a strong academic record
  • 7+ years experience in finance transformation and programme management, ideally within the insurance sector. 
  • Strong consulting background, or similar industry experience, with a proven track record of delivering complex transformation projects. 
  • Experience with project management - PMP, PRINCE II, Agile desirable
  • Deep understanding of insurance finance operations, reporting, regulatory frameworks, and industry challenges. 
  • Experience across the full lifecycle of transformation projects, from strategy through to implementation. 
  • Expertise in finance technologies, ERP and EPM systems, and process automation. 
  • Excellent stakeholder management and communication skills, with the ability to influence at senior levels. 
  • Experience working cross functionally with finance, actuarial and operations teams in an insurance setting.
  • Experience with data flows and key upstream and downstream finance data sets. 
  • Strong analytical, problem-solving, and project management skills. 
  • Collaborative mindset with a passion for innovation and continuous improvement. 
  • Ability to mentor and develop high-performing teams.

Your responsibilities and achievements will evolve as you enhance your career with us. Here is what you can initially expect:

  • Lead large-scale finance transformation projects for insurance sector clients, ensuring delivery of high-quality outcomes.
  • Build and maintain long-term client relationships, acting as a trusted advisor on finance transformation and programme management.
  • Oversee diverse project teams, fostering a collaborative and inclusive environment.
  • Drive stakeholder alignment and manage senior client relationships across multiple business units.
  • Design, plan, and execute end-to-end finance transformation programmes, including operating model redesign, shared services, and digital finance initiatives.
  • Monitor project progress, manage risks and issues, and ensure timely delivery of milestones.
  • Provide subject matter expertise in insurance finance operations, regulatory requirements, and industry trends.
  • Advise clients on finance process automation, ERP implementation, and performance management solutions.
  • Stay current on emerging technologies and regulatory changes impacting the insurance sector

Your team:

Our Finance Transformation team advise clients on how to embrace the future of finance and how to use process improvement, technology and AI methodologies to:

  • Transform their finance function
  • Define their finance target operating models
  • Make finance operations more efficient
  • Understand regulatory reporting requirements and address them
